Section 2. Installing the PX-760A Internal ATAPI Drive
• Emergency eject hole: If the automatic eject button does not work,
insert the emergency eject tool, paper clip, or other thin, rigid object
in this hole to eject tray. Turn OFF power before using this feature.
• Tray front door: Attached to tray drawer.
• Eject button: Push once to eject tray. Push again to insert the tray
back into the PX-760A. To prevent wear on the drive, always use the
eject button to insert the tray.
Rear Panel—PX-760A Internal Drive
Also familiarize yourself with the drive's rear panel.
Figure 2: Rear panel of the PX-760A internal ATAPI drive
• Digital audio output connector: Outputs a digital stereo signal. Use
this to connect to a sound board that supports Sony/Philips Digital
Interface (SPDIF) or Digital-In.
• Analog audio output connector: Not used.
